In the end i just did a execution only application online with current provider (nationwide).
Couldnt reduce term, or amount without a proper application so i will just overpay again.
Got a 2 year tracker at 1.24% above base with no fees at a 36%LTV on their calculations . which seems not too bad. Yes there are slightly better deals but i couldn't be bothered with the hassle. More importantly i can overpay as much as i like and also no ERC so i can keep chipping away at the debt.
